Output 58167846992283a63830ff3931ef9ce14e3eb808131f6cbaa2ad173a8e674984:6

value
10737261
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 507f3bbd9d9d4ac5e53157bff3d516d24a4dc76d OP_EQUALVERIFY OP_CHECKSIG
address
18LdUgB5i6htvLqxbg68dy8Q9tpjiEbSkL
transaction
58167846992283a63830ff3931ef9ce14e3eb808131f6cbaa2ad173a8e674984
spent
true